Coronation celebrations held across Northern Ireland for bank holiday
Briefly

A number of street parties and events were held on bank holiday Monday in certain communities across Northern Ireland to mark the coronation of the King.Some neighbourhoods organised street parties with music, food and dancing.Streets were decorated with Union flags and bunting, while partygoers were seen wearing red, white and blue flower necklaces and hair ties.
